Specifications
Frequency Stability: ±25ppm
Current - Supply (Disable) (Max): 10µA
Height - Seated (Max): 0.039" (1.00mm)
Size / Dimension: 0.276" L x 0.197" W (7.00mm x 5.00mm)
Package / Case: 4-SMD, No Lead
Mounting Type: Surface Mount
Ratings: --
Current - Supply (Max): 31mA
Operating Temperature: -20°C ~ 70°C
Absolute Pull Range (APR): --
Series: SiT8208
Voltage - Supply: 1.8V
Output: LVCMOS, LVTTL
Function: Standby (Power Down)
Frequency: 33.3MHz
Type: XO (Standard)
Base Resonator: MEMS
Part Status: Active
Packaging: Tape & Reel (TR)
